I am looking through v7 of the performance guide, from Dec2004 and I
have noticed,
The optimal bufpool size is from 1/8 to 1/2 of real memory
but, SELFTUNEBUFPOOLSIZE, is limited to allocating 10% of the memory
under unix.
1/8=12.5% , so SELFTUNEBUFPOOLSIZE is limited to a value that is below
the recommended optimal?
